Validation of License Legitimacy

Fraudulent operators sometimes show fake licensing badges, making verification crucial when gambling sites not on GamStop for your gaming pursuits. Go to the regulatory body’s official site directly and search their licensing database using the operator’s license number rather than clicking links within the casino app itself.

Authentic licenses contain specific reference numbers, issue dates, and operator details that match the casino’s registered business information, providing vital verification when gambling sites not on GamStop that meets security standards. Reach out to the licensing authority if you encounter discrepancies or cannot find the operator within official registers before making any deposits.
